Hilsea Station offers a range of basic fac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Although there isn't a dedicated ticket office, ticket machines are conveniently placed to assist with pur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ets. These machines are accessible and support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ring inclusivity for all travelers.
If you're in need of information or assistance, a help point is available, but do note that staff assistance isn't present on-site. When traveling dispatches assistance is managed by the train Guards, so should you require aid, make yourself known to them upon boarding. Unfortunately, the station doesn’t have amenities such as toilets, wa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or an ATM, so it’s advised to plan ahead. CCTV is present to ensure safety and security across the premises.
For those needing step-free access, Hilsea Station provides limited capabilities through short, albeit steep, ramps to both platforms. Inter-platform interchange poses a choice between traversing a footbridge with steps or taking a longer step-free route across roads and paths. It’s important to plan your journey with these factors in mind if accessibility is a priority.
While accessible ticket machines and ramps for train access are available, facilities like accessible toilets and waiting rooms are absent. Passenger planning tools such as helplines and customer help points are provided to facilitate better travel arrangements.
Transitioning from train to other modes of transport is streamlined, with convenient bus stops accessible on Norway Road, aimed at Portsmouth, Cosham, and Havant neighborhoods. For impromptu rail replacement needs, these stops are aptly stationed by the Vauxhall Garage vicinity.

Thames Ditton might be quaint, but it comes equipped with essential facilities to ease your travel experience. Ticket buying and collection are straightforward, with an operational ticket office open from Monday to Saturday and ticket machines available for collection of online purchases. These machines are designed to assist everyone, including offering discounts through the Disabled Persons Railcard.
If you need customer support, you can access information via the helpful point; however, note that there's no staff help available on-site. Safety is a priority with CCTV surveillance, and while there isn't a waiting room, there is a comfortable seating area to relax in. Keep in mind, there are no toilets, baby changing facilities, or dedicated cycle hire services available here. However, with secure bicycle storage, it's a rider-friendly station.
Accessibility is partially supported with step-free access available on certain platforms. The gradients can be quite steep, especially on platform 2, so it's worthwhile checking ahead if mobility is a concern. Although there are no dedicated accessible taxis or set-down points, assistance is readily available by notifying the train guard who is present when trains are running.
Thames Ditton station's location provides seamless connections with nearby towns and London. Not only is there a dependable bus service for your onward journey but also rail replacement services are operational for routes towards Surbiton and Hampton Court.
